Hull, Massachusetts, a small coastal town on the South Shore peninsula, is home to a handful of reading specialists listed in our directory who work with students facing a range of literacy challenges. Among the four tutors listed here, three hold credentials in the Wilson Reading System, a structured-literacy approach that follows an explicit, multisensory sequence and is frequently used with students who have dyslexia, decoding difficulties, or persistent phonics gaps.
